Due to cabling restrictions, I was recently forced to go wireless in a few instances.  I bought a Linksys BEFW11S4 router and the Linksys WUSB11 Wireless USB Adapter.  Both have the latest firmware, drivers, etc.  I have one wireless connection (basement to router) and 3 wired connections.  The wired connections have all worked flawlessly in the past, so there is not a problem with the cabling.
Once I installed the router I noticed a new occurence. All connections, both wireless and wired, were experiencing some freaky stuff. For example, web pages needed to be refreshed to be loaded, there were constant timeouts, connections to FTP would drop, etc. This never used to happen with the network being just hard-wired. I could see there might be interference or what-not if only the Wireless connection was being affected, but all connections are having problems. For example, on AIM, theres constantly a 1-2 min delay between sending IMs and/or viewing a buddies profile, and with America Online (which my parents use on the network), theres always a timeout while trying to sign on, sign off, or switching screen names. I exchanged the router for a new one, yet still the same problem. What I found is that when I choose an IP address to be under the DMZ, that specific host works fine. 100%, no time-outs, no problems whatsoever. Doesn't matter if its wired or wireless, things function as they should with that host when its chosen under DMZ.
Anyone have any suggestions or clue to what may be happening?
